An iterative method for solving problems in neutron transport theory is described. The method uses the result of a low-order spherical harmonies calculation as the initial function and attempts to improve this with one iteration. The results for the one-velocity Boltzmann equation with plane symmetry show that good accuracy is obtained for many practical cases.
